Black Lightning Actor Teases Big Scenes Coming
One of the things that makes the new CW show Black Lightning so interesting is that this hero has already do the superhero thing before, and that means his characters are already established, we just have to learn more about them. One of them is Peter Gambi, the man who helped make the suit for Jefferson Pierce, and the one who believes that he is needed now more than ever.
James Remar talked with ComicBookResrouces.com about his character, and what the future holds for him, as well as reveals of what his past was before he was a “tailor”.
“I can say that he has a background in covert operations, maybe a little bit of military, prior to his becoming a “tailor.” So all this scientific expertise and technological know-how is birthed from his backstory, which will be revealed as we go on. But I think it’s cool that, in the beginning, he’s got this tailor shop with a sliding bookcase and — all of a sudden — you’ve got this inner sanctum with all this cool stuff!”
Remar also notes that later episodes in the season will see some big scenes between Rambi and Black Lightning, some of which hasn’t been filmed just yet:
“I’m excited for them to see the whole thing. We did a nice scene a couple of weeks ago that he and I had a falling out and then we have a coming back together, but we’re going to fall out again. There’s a big reveal in episode 8 and 9 and 10 that all remain to be shot, but I’m aware of the arc at this point. I know 8 and I’ve glanced at 9 and I’m excited to play them, so hopefully that translates into people being excited to see it.”
